Introduction to Static Balers and Compactors
Businesses are placing increasing importance on managing waste efficiently. Static balers and compactors offer a dependable method for handling large amounts of waste.
These machines are fixed in place and designed for continuous operation at a single site. Balers are used to compress recyclables into dense, transportable units.
This makes storage and transportation more efficient. Compactors process general waste by reducing its overall size.
Containment within the system supports safer and cleaner operations. They are particularly useful in areas where waste builds up quickly.
Best Applications for Static Balers
They are ideal for operations with a steady flow of recyclable materials. They are frequently used in warehouses and retail operations.
Large volumes of cardboard can reduce available workspace. Compressing waste reduces clutter and improves site efficiency.
Baled materials are more convenient for recycling partners to process. This can improve recycling performance and reduce landfill waste.
The Function of Static Compactors
Static compactors manage non-recyclable waste efficiently. Waste is compressed into a closed system, lowering collection needs.
Uncontained waste can cause problems such as smells and pest activity. Compactors help minimise these risks by keeping waste enclosed.
They contribute to safer and more controlled waste handling. This reduces the likelihood of accidents caused by loose materials.

Choosing Between Balers and Compactors
The decision depends largely on the waste stream. Balers work best with recyclable waste streams.
Static compactors are designed for non-recyclable waste. In certain cases, combining both systems improves efficiency.
Planning Installation
These machines need a fixed location with adequate working space. Access for collection vehicles must also be considered.
Selecting the right size depends on waste output levels. Oversized or undersized systems can affect efficiency.
Routine maintenance ensures continued performance. Well-built systems minimise disruption and last longer.
